Is Blaze Fast-Fire'd Pizza - W. Lake Mead clean?
Blaze Fast-Fire'd Pizza - W. Lake Mead is currently Grade A from Southern Nevada Health District (SNHD), from an inspection on February 25, 2026. No critical violations were recorded at that visit. On Cooked's ladder that reads clean π.
What did inspectors find at Blaze Fast-Fire'd Pizza - W. Lake Mead?
Nothing was written up at the most recent inspection on February 25, 2026. A clean sheet like this is the best possible result β no violations of any severity were recorded.

How Las Vegas grades restaurants
The Southern Nevada Health District grades on demerits, and here more is worse: roughly 0β10 demerits earns an A, 11β20 a B, and 21 or more a C. Serious problems can skip the ladder entirely β an imminent health hazard gets the permit suspended and the kitchen shut on the spot, which shows up as a closure rather than a letter. SNHD covers all of Clark County, so Henderson, North Las Vegas and the unincorporated Strip all run the same scheme. Cooked reads A as clean, B as mid, C or a closure as cooked.
